Establishes a monthly reporting requirement for carriers delivering wine, malt beverages, or distilled spirits in Massachusetts.
This bill amends Chapter 138 of the General Laws to require every parcel delivery service or trucking business delivering wine, malt beverages, or distilled spirits to consumers in Massachusetts to submit monthly reports to the Commission. These reports must include details such as the origin of the shipment, the shipper's and recipient's information, and the weight of the wine shipped. The requirement does not apply to deliveries from Certificate of Compliance holders to wholesalers. Violations of this reporting requirement may result in license suspension or revocation.
